In this research, sol-gel bioactive glass in SiO2 �-P2O5 ? CaO - Na2O system using common nitrate precursors was investigated. Some parameters like water/alcohol/TEOS ratio, type of catalyst (acid or alkali) and temperature of heat treatment were also studied. At present, typical approaches employed to repair fractures and other bone lesions tend to use matrix grafts to promote tissue regeneration. These grafts act as templates, which promote cellular adhesion, growth and proliferation, osteoconduction, and even osteoinduction, which commonly results in de novo osteogenesis.
